Cathy recorded the percent of her clothing that is red, yellow, blue, or orange. The results are shown in the table (in the picture). If Cathy has 145 pieces of clothing, how many pieces of yellow clothing does she own?
Step One. first what you want to do you want to convert 20% into a decimal and a way to do that you need to move a decimal two times to the left. when finding the percent of something you will always move the decimal two times to left
Step 2. now that you have your 20% into a decimal you will multiply 145 by .20
